For those not familiar, UUX is a special interest group of the Society for Technical Communication and serves a unique role for those interested in bringing user-centered design into their technical communication work as well as those wanting to transition into a full-time UX role. This community is where I first learned about UX and started making my career transition (in the interest of disclosure, I'm also a past manager of the community).<br />
<br />
UUX is an open community, so you can learn more about its many services before joining STC. The UUX website alone (also linked in the <a href="http://uxwatercooler.ning.com/page/page/show?id=2085916%3APage%3A921">UX Library</a>) is a tremendous resource.
